What is an Psychiatry Expert?

Psychiatry experts are medical specialists focusing on the diagnosis, treatment, and avoidance of mental health disorders. They bring understanding from both medicine and psychology to attend to numerous mental health conditions, including however not limited to anxiety disorders, depression, schizophrenia, and bipolar illness.

Credentials of Psychiatry Experts

To end up being a psychiatry professional, people must undergo extensive training. Below is a table summing up the normal academic course and credentials required for this occupation.

StageDetails
Undergraduate EducationBachelor's degree, frequently in psychology, biology, or a related field.
Medical SchoolFour years of medical training leading to an MD (Doctor of Medicine) or DO (Doctor of Osteopathy).
Residency4 years of residency in psychiatry, focusing on scientific training in identifying and treating mental disorders.
Fellowship (Optional)Additional specialized training in locations such as kid psychiatry, geriatric psychiatry, or forensic psychiatry.
Board CertificationNeed to pass an accreditation test from the American Board of Psychiatry and Neurology (ABPN) or a comparable body in their nation.

Role of Psychiatry Experts

Psychiatry experts play various roles that exceed simply dealing with mental disease. Here are some key functions they carry out:

  1. Diagnosis of Mental Health Disorders:
    Psychiatry experts utilize a mix of interviews, physical evaluations, and psychological assessments to detect mental health conditions properly.
  2. Advancement of Treatment Plans:
    They produce customized treatment plans that may consist of psychiatric therapy, medication management, way of life modifications, or a combination of these approaches.
  3. Medication Management:
    Psychiatry experts are qualified to recommend medications like antidepressants, antipsychotics, and mood stabilizers.
  4. Therapeutic Interventions:
    They frequently supply different types of psychiatric therapy, including cognitive-behavioral treatment (CBT), dialectical behavior therapy (DBT), and psychoanalysis.
  5. Research study and Education:
    Many psychiatry experts are included in research to advance the field and frequently add to educating clients and the general public about mental health.
  6. Assessment and Collaboration:
    They typically deal with other health care experts, such as psychologists, social workers, and medical doctors, to supply extensive care.

Fields Within Psychiatry

Psychiatry is a diverse field with a number of subspecialties that cater to different populations and issues. Below is a list highlighting various fields within psychiatry:

  • General Psychiatry: Focuses on diagnosing and dealing with a wide range of mental health problems.
  • Child and Adolescent Psychiatry: Specializes in the mental health of children and teenagers.
  • Geriatric Psychiatry: Deals with the mental health of elderly clients, often addressing problems like dementia and anxiety in later life.
  • Forensic Psychiatry: Integrates psychiatry and the law, focusing on clients associated with legal cases.
  • Dependency Psychiatry: Focuses on treating people with substance usage disorders.
  • Emergency situation Psychiatry: Provides immediate take care of individuals in severe psychiatric crises.
